Thaipusam 2007

Posted by diligo on February 1, 2007

1st Feb, my medical appointment at SGH, Doctor Tan would surely give me an mc that’s for sure…after having seen him for the past two years almost..Today is also the day of Thaipusam

I was there last year covering the event at Tank Road, the end of the walk from the temple at Serangoon Road. The atmosphere is indeed infectious! The colors, the endurance shown by the khavadi walkers…, the focus and the ambiance of the place really makes one want to go back each year to soak in the event..So, here am I in 2007, fulfilling that promise to go back to this festival to cover the event!

After waking up at 5.30am, preparing all my gears, one camera, 2 lens….and my trusty 400AW..had breakfast, walk my dog, Tiger, read a little and then set off at 7.20am…reached there at 7.50am almost..I reckon I had about 1 hour to shoot, so had little choice but to go to the temple at Tank Road…cos the medical appointment is 0900hrs…but never had I seen the doctor at the appointed time…Oh well, that’s a story for another day!

Back to the festival, it never cease to amaze me why these khavadi walkers never bleed when they get all sorts of piercing on their bodies…and the boundless energy they show by dancing, jumping, when they are near the end of their journey..I bet they must have been really tired but their faith kept them strong…
